Sr. Research Associate - RI Gene Ther Vaidy

Nationwide Children's Hospital is dedicated to providing high-quality healthcare and research. The Sr. Research Associate will coordinate laboratory research activities, conduct independent studies, and assist in preparing scientific publications and grant proposals.
ChildrenHealth CareMedical
check
H1B Sponsor Likelynote

Responsibilities

Conducts independent research studies and laboratory analysis in conjunction with a principal investigator. Performs research experiments independently in accordance with protocols approved by PI. Organizes research experiments, appropriately arranges subjects, and maintains records
Collects experimental data, conducts analysis in accordance with statistical procedures, and retains accurate logs of methods, results, and conclusions. Prepares reports, including graphs, tables, and photographs, of the results for PI review
Collaborates and interacts with other researchers doing similar studies. Serves as a resource for other investigators and as a mentor to less experienced research personnel. Coordinates activities of employees in laboratory research. Serves as an experienced resource for other Investigators and mentors less experienced research staff
Observes difficulties encountered in set up and conduction. Assists the PI with the preparation of scientific publications and grant proposals. Attends scientific conferences and gives scientific presentations
Orders and maintains inventory, ensures equipment is in working order, and prepares budget proposals for equipment and supplies required to conduct research
Monitors study expenditures to assure that budgetary constraints are followed and that research studies are conducted within budget. Assists with preparing research budgets and prepares budget proposals for future research projects

Required

Bachelor's Degree in relevant field
Ability to use research methods in generating and collecting data and analyzing the data for report preparation
Ability to develop complex position papers and reports and help in preparation of research grant proposals and scientific publications
Effective computer skills
Two years of post-degree research experience, or one year with a Master's Degree

Preferred

Master's Degree
